We’ve all got limited resources, time, energy, focus etc – so if you had to choose between going all in on your strengths or working on areas where you aren’t as strong, what would you choose?
No matter who you have been or what you have done in the past, I believe it’s important to strike a balance between going all in on our strengths and working on areas where we may not be as strong.
Focusing on strengths is crucial because it allows us to excel in areas where we have a natural talent and passion. This is where we often find our true calling and can make the most significant impact.
However, neglecting weaknesses completely can limit our overall growth. I’ve learned this through my leveling up journey. While I emphasized my strengths in image transformation and personal development, I also recognized that there were areas I needed to improve, such as adaptability quiet power of confidence, positive impression on listeners, develop calm and efective techniques and networking. So, I invested effort in those weaker areas, which enhanced my ability to navigate new challenges and build a robust network.
In essence, being well-rounded provides a more solid foundation and the flexibility to adapt to changing circumstances. It’s about capitalizing on your strengths while not letting your weaknesses hold you back.
